The Role
As a Civil Engineer Level I with Worley, you will work closely with our existing team to deliver projects for our clients while continuing to develop your skills and experience etc.
Preliminary & Detailed Design
Develop horizontal/vertical alignments, profiles, and cross-sections for roads, highways, and internal plant roads.
Produce grading models, earthwork optimization, and cut-fill balancing for sites, well pads, process areas, and utility corridors.
Civil 3D Production & BIM Coordination
Build and manage Civil 3D surfaces, corridors, assemblies, subassemblies, pipe networks, grading objects, and quantity take-offs.
Set up and maintain data shortcuts, styles, templates, and production standards for consistent deliverables.
Coordinate with BIM/VDC teams for model federation and clash detection across civil, structural, and underground services.
Technical Documentation & Approvals
Prepare drawings and documents: plan & profile, typical cross-sections, road furniture/signage/markings, grading plans, BoQs, method statements, design reports, and IFC packages.
Support authority submissions and client/PMC reviews, respond to RFIs, and incorporate review comments efficiently.
Key Deliverables
Alignment geometry, profiles, cross-sections, corridor models and quantity take-offs.
Grading plans, earthwork summaries, and mass haul diagrams.
Signage/markings, safety barriers/guardrails layouts, and road furniture details.
IFC drawing sets, BoQs, method statements, and design reports.
Model coordination outputs (clash reports, federation snapshots) and as-built updates.

About You
To be considered for this role it is envisaged you will possess the following attributes:
Must-Have Qualifications
B.E./B.Tech in Civil Engineering (M.E./M.Tech preferred).
8–10 years of hands-on design experience in roads/highways and site development; demonstrable exposure to O&G/industrial infrastructure (greenfield/brownfield).
Advanced proficiency in Autodesk Civil 3D: surfaces, corridors, intersections, pipe networks, grading, labels/styles, data shortcuts; strong drawing production skills.
Familiarity with international road and highway design standards, including AASHTO, DMRB, AUSTROADS, and Gulf MOR, with the ability to apply these codes effectively in multidisciplinary infrastructure projects.
Experience preparing BoQs/estimates, design reports, and IFC packages.
Strong coordination and communication skills with multidisciplinary teams (Civil/Structural/Mechanical/E&I/Process).
Demonstrated commitment to HSE and constructability in industrial settings.
Nice-to-Have / Preferred
Basic to intermediate Navisworks/InfraWorks/ReCap workflow knowledge for context and model reviews.
Understanding of pavement design (flexible/rigid), subgrade improvement, and geotechnical interfaces.
Experience with BIM execution plans (BEP), model coordination meetings, and clash resolution workflows.
Prior experience with Middle East or SE Asia authority standards (if applicable to your projects).
